Frequently Asked Questions about Long Beach
How much are Studio apartments in Long Beach?
There are currently 2,532 Studio Apartments in Long Beach with rent ranges from $1,250 to $4,167 with an average price of $2,149.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Long Beach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Long Beach ranges from $1,100 to $8,186 with an average monthly rent of $2,480.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Long Beach c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Long Beach range from $1,725 to $9,498.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,118.
How expensive are Long Beach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,051 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Long Beach on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,245 to $12,287 - averaging $3,492 for the location.
